Sheikh Hasina. FOCUS BANGLA/file photoPrime Minister Sheikh Hasina left London for home Wednesday (Aug 7) afternoon (London time) wrapping up her official visit to the United Kingdom (UK).
“A Biman Bangladesh Airlines VVIP flight carrying the prime minister and her entourage departed from Heathrow International Airport in London for Dhaka at 6:55pm (London time),” PM’s Press Secretary Ihsanul Karim told BSS over phone from London.
Bangladesh High Commissioner to the UK Saida Muna Tasneem saw the premier off at the airport.
The flight is scheduled to land at Hazrat Shahjalal International Airport in Dhaka early on Thursday (Aug 8).
Sheikh Hasina went to London on Jul 19.
During her stay there, the premier attended the Bangladeshi envoys’ conference on Jul 20.
Commonwealth Secretary General Patricia Scotland QC and Lord Ahmad of Wimbledon separately called on Sheikh Hasina in the British capital.
On Jul 22, the prime minister underwent a successful surgery in her left eye at a London hospital, the press secretary said.
